Ingredients

Noodles
- 8 oz noodles (egg noodles or rice noodles)
Beef and Sauce
- 1 lb ground beef
- 3 tablespoons vegetable oil
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 inch piece of ginger, grated
- 1 medium onion, sliced
- 1 red bell pepper, sliced
- 1 cup carrots, julienned
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 2 tablespoons oyster sauce
- 1 tablespoon hoisin sauce
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- 1/2 teaspoon red chili flakes (optional)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Garnish
- 3 green onions, chopped
Instructions
- Cook the noodles: Start by cooking the noodles according to the package instructions. Once cooked, drain and set aside. Toss them with a little oil to prevent sticking and keep them separated while preparing the rest of the dish.
- Brown the ground beef: Heat the vegetable o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Add the ground beef and cook for 5-7 minutes, breaking it apart with a spatula, until browned and cooked through.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Remove the beef from the skillet and set aside, leaving the oil and juices in the pan.
- Sauté aromatics: In the same skillet, add the minced garlic and grated ginger. S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ant, which will infuse the oil with aromatic flavor.
- Cook the vegetables: Add the sliced onion, red bell pepper, and julienned carrots to the skillet. Sauté for 3-4 minutes until the vegetables are tender-crisp, maintaining some crunch and freshness.
- Combine beef and vegetables: Return the cooked ground beef back to the skillet with the vegetables, mixing everything evenly.
- Prepare the sauce: In a small bowl, whisk together soy sauce, oyster sauce, hoisin sauce, brown sugar, sesame oil, and red chili flakes if using. Pour this sauce mixture over the ground beef and vegetable mixture in the skillet.
- Simmer and coat: Stir well to combine all ingredients and let them heat through for 2-3 minutes, allowing the sauce to thicken slightly and coat the beef and vegetables thoroughly.
- Add noodles and combine: Toss the cooked noodles into the skillet. Gently mix to coat the noodles evenly with the sauce, beef, and vegetables. Cook for an additional minute to heat the noodles through and blend flavors.
- Garnish and serve: Sprinkle the chopped green onions over the dish as a fresh, crunchy garnish. Serve hot for a delicious and satisfying meal.
Notes
- You can substitute ground beef with ground turkey or chicken for a leaner option.
- Use gluten-free soy sauce to make this recipe gluten-free if needed.
- Adjust red chili flakes according to your preferred spice level or omit for a milder flavor.
- If you prefer softer vegetables, increase the sauté time by a couple of minutes.
-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and rewarmed before serving.
